How it works

  1. Cast Uro by paying 1G manaU mana
  2. When Uro enters the battlefield, its first and second abilities trigger, as well as Deadeye Navigator's soulbond ability.
  3. Resolve the Deadeye Navigator trigger, pairing it and Uro.
  4. Resolve the second Uro trigger, causing you to draw a card, gain 3 life, and put Izzet Boilerworks from your hand onto the battlefield.
  5. When Izzet Boilerworks enters untapped due to Spelunking, it triggers.
  6. Holding priority, activate Izzet Boilerworks by tapping it, adding U manaR mana.
  7. Resolve the Izzet Boilerworks trigger, returning it from the battlefield to your hand.
  8. Activate Uro by paying 1U mana, blinking it.
  9. Repeat from step 2.

This clever loop puts Deadeye Navigator to work as a repeatable engine, soulbonded to Uro, Titan of Nature's Wrath so you can blink the Elder Giant before its sacrifice trigger catches up to it. Spelunking does the heavy lifting for your mana base, ensuring that when Izzet Boilerworks re-enters the battlefield, it arrives completely untapped and ready to generate resources without slowing your pace. By floating mana from Izzet Boilerworks in response to its own bounce trigger, you fund the blink cost to repeat the entire cycle, drawing your deck and triggering Uro's life-gaining arrival over and over again.
